James Arthur "Jim" Kelly


James Arthur Kelly, 82, passed from this life to the next on May 18, 2014.

He was born on March 13, 1932, in Aberdeen, South Dakota, to Arthur Vincent and Joyce Heinz Kelly.

Jim grew up in Scottsbluff, Nebraska and graduated from Scottsbluff High School in 1950.

He then enlisted in the Marine Corps in 1951 and rose to the ranks of sergeant before receiving an honorable discharge in 1954.

Jim then attended college at Creighton University in Omaha, Nebraska and graduated with a Bachelors of Science in Accounting in 1959.

He began his career in public accounting joining Arthur Young and Company in Kansas City, Missouri before moving to the private sector with Spencer Chemical Company in 1963 as an internal auditor.

Jim married Ann Patricia (Nancy) Dougherty in 1965 and started a family. He then moved to Bird and Fletcher Company in 1967 as Controller. Jim moved his family to Houston, Texas where he joined Gulf Oil Company in 1969.

He obtained his CPA license from the state of Texas in 1972 and later that same year accepted a transfer to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ania with Gulf.

In 1978, he was named Manager of Investor Relations with Texas and Oil Gas Corporation in Dallas, Texas.

In 1979, Jim joined Phillips Petroleum Company in Bartlesville, Oklahoma where he eventually was named Corporate Comptroller before retiring in 1992.

In retirement Jim was active in Holy Family Cathedral, volunteered time at St. John's Hospital in Tulsa and was an active member of Financial Executives International.
